How much does a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way make in Illinois? The average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way salary in Illinois is $166,990 as of March 26, 2024, but the range typically falls between $149,690 and $188,860.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on the city and many other important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ession.

Job Description

The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way reviews designs, tests and assesses materials, and performs necessary data collection and calculations in areas such as traffic forecasting, soil capacity, groundwater analysis, and structure design. Designs and supervises construction projects such as airports, bridges, channels, dams, railroads, or roads. Being a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way may also assist in inspecting aging infrastructure or overseeing improvement projects. Responsibilities also include estimating costs, estimating personnel and material needs, preparing proposals, and establishing completion dates. In addition,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way requires a bachelor's degree in engineering. May require a Professional Engineer License (PE).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. Being a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way works autonomously. Goals are generally communicated in "solution" or project goal terms. May provide a leadership role for the work group through knowledge in the area of specialization. Works on advanced, complex technical projects or business issues requiring state of the art technical or industry knowledge. Working as a Civil Engineer, Lead - Road / Highway typically requires 10+ years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)
